How much do print finisher j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 10, 2026, the average hourly pay for print finisher in the United States is $16.73,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.38 and $17.07 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are print finishers?

Print finishers are skilled professionals who specialize in the final stages of the printing process. They are responsible for assembling, binding, trimming, folding, and packaging printed materials to meet quality and client specifications. Their work ensures that printed products such as books, brochures, magazines, and promotional materials are presentable, durable, and ready for distribution. Print finishers often operate specialized machines and may work with various materials, including paper, cardboard, and plastic.

What Is a Print Finisher?

A print finisher assembles books, newspapers, or magazines for print. As a print finisher, your daily duties include folding, cutting, stapling, or gluing paper as necessary. Print finishers set up machinery, feed the machine with paper, and maintain the equipment to ensure that the end product looks exactly right. For proper imaging and proper photo printing, a print finisher consults with their clients or managers to confirm print quality.

What is the difference between Print Finisher vs Bindery Worker?

Print FinisherBindery Worker
Prepares printed materials for distribution, including trimming, folding, and assemblingPerforms binding tasks such as stapling, binding, and finishing printed products

Both roles require skills in handling printed materials, often involve similar equipment, and are used in printing and publishing industries. The Print Finisher focuses on finalizing printed products through trimming and folding, while the Bindery Worker specializes in binding and assembling books or booklets. They often work together but have distinct responsibilities in the finishing process.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Print Finisher,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Print Finisher, you need a solid understanding of print production processes, attention to detail, and manual dexterity, often supported by vocational training or on-the-job experience. Familiarity with finishing equipment such as guillotines, laminators, binding machines, and quality control systems is typically required. Strong organizational skills, problem-solving abilities, and teamwork help Print Finishers deliver high-quality finished products on time. These skills ensure accuracy, efficiency, and customer satisfaction in the fast-paced print industry.

What are some common challenges faced by Print Finishers, and how can they be managed effectively?

Print Finishers often encounter challenges such as tight deadlines, handling a variety of complex finishing equipment, and ensuring high-quality standards on every project. Managing these challenges involves str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and effective communication with the print production team. Adapting quickly to last-minute changes and maintaining equipment in top condition are also crucial for smooth workflow and consistent results. Building experience in troubleshooting machinery and collaborating closely with designers and press operators can greatly enhance efficiency and job satisfaction.

Job description

Description

We are seeking a detail-oriented Print Finisher to join our team. The ideal candidate will be responsible for completing the final stages of the printing process, ensuring that all printed materials meet quality standards and are ready for distribution. This role requires a keen eye for detail, strong organizational skills, and the ability to work efficiently in a fast-paced environment.


Key Responsibilities:

- Operate and maintain print finishing equipment.

- Inspect printed materials for quality and accuracy, making necessary adjustments as needed.

- Perform various finishing tasks such as binding, weeding, coating and cleating.

- Collaborate with the manufacturing team to ensure timely completion of projects.

- Maintain a clean and organized work area, adhering to safety protocols.


Skills and Qualifications:

- High school diploma or equivalent.

- Previous experience in print, print finishing or a related field is preferred.

- Strong attention to detail and quality control.

- Ability to work independently and as part of a team.

- Excellent time management and organizational skills.
